Jazz File

on BBC Radio 3

Teaching Jazz. In the first of a four-part series, Alyn Shipton asks if it's possible to teach jazz. Saxophonist Phil Woods thinks not, but educationalist Jamie Aebersold believes it is. With vibraphonist
Gary Burton , the programme looks at America's firstjazz school, Berklee College, Boston, and Avril Dankworth , Michael Garrick and Graham Collier rememberthe first British attempts to integratejazz and education.
